The Risk Of Over Weight

Risk involved with your over weight is much more.

v More likely to suffer from HIGH ACIDITY and HEARTBURN.
v Ten times more likely to suffer from DIABETES.
v Six times more likely to develop HEART DISEASES.
v More likely to suffer from LOW BACK PAIN and ARTHRITIS.
v Who are women are more likely to suffer from IRREGULAR MENSTRUAL PERIODS and HORMONAL IMBALANCE AFFECTING THE OVARIES.
Over weight is directly related with calories intake. Calories which we take as our daily meal is the main source of energy – we burnt that calories by our daily work. If there is an imbalance between intake calories and burnt calories that means intake calories are more than burnt calories then it get converted and stored as fat in our body.


Common Reasons Of Weight Gain

Heredity – Obesity is sometimes linked with heredity. However, it is possible to control weight through a balanced diet, even if your parents are overweight.

Age – Only 1/3 of obese adults have been so since childhood. Most gain weight as adults, mainly due to sedentary lifestyle.

Sedentary lifestyle – Modern day work involves little physical activity as machines do most of the work. As a result, fewer calories are burnt as compared to those consumed.

Eating habits – an average person requires 2100kcal/day. When person consumes more calories than required, he may gain weight because of unwanted fat. Even an extra 100kcal/day leads to a gain of 5kg a year.

Another indicator of excess weight is your Body Mass Index(BMI). BMI is a measure to determine the total body fat.

BMI = Wight (in kg) / Height (in mtr)2 [ 1ft = 0.3048 meter ]

If your BMI is in between 19 and 25 are indicators of ideal weight. If it’s over 25 that indicates that you are overweight and when its over 30 then its obesity.
